LandSpace Launches Zhuque-3, China's First Reusable Rocket, Achieving Orbital Insertion

SPACE ECONOMY

On December 3, LandSpace successfully launched Zhuque-3, China's first reusable rocket, achieving orbital insertion from the Dongfeng Commercial Space Innovation Pilot Zone. While the mission marked a significant advancement in China's space capabilities, the first stage experienced an abnormal burn and crashed during descent. This launch highlights the rapid growth of China's commercial space sector, bolstered by government incentives since 2015.
